Foster left Les Misérables to join the ensemble of Thoroughly Modern Millie in its pre-Broadway run at the La Jolla Playhouse. With only nine days remaining before the first preview, Foster took over the role of Millie Dilmount. Sutton Foster, in full Sutton Lenore Foster, (born March 18, 1975, Statesboro, Georgia, U.S.), American actress and singer whose high-spirited charisma and brightly expressive voice brought her fame in Broadway musical theatre. Foster’s breakthrough came in 2000 when she was cast in Thoroughly Modern Millie, a new musical based on the 1967 film about an independent-minded woman in the 1920s.
